Moot Court and Library at Gwalior Law College, Gwalior

  • The 3-year LLB at Gwalior Law College covers constitutional law, and electives over six semesters
  • BCI recognition means graduates can enroll as advocates.
  • The 5-year integrated BA LLB combines undergraduate education with law for 12th-grade students.
  • Moot court practice and court internships are built into both programmes.

Law admission at the institution for 2026: graduates targeting 3-year LLB need 45%+ in any bachelor's degree. 12th-grade students targeting integrated LLB need 45%+ in 10+2 and CLAT or Madhya Pradesh law test performance. CLAT for June admission at Gwalior Law College: register between November and December and prepare well in advance.
